Output 4612895dcaed3fe610d2e84d5745865cd05d52e8a4088842f4df79797583f3a9:14

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7dc4e3f6e302a63e4f9304695b9ab6a2db55c299f21fe932d26967942edef20
address
bc1pulwyu0mwxq4x8e8exprftwdtdgkm2hpfnuslayedy6t8jshdausq3r5rpr
transaction
4612895dcaed3fe610d2e84d5745865cd05d52e8a4088842f4df79797583f3a9
spent
true